Programme Overview
The Professional Certificate in Topological Analysis for Structural Integrity is a specialized program designed for engineers, architects, and researchers focused on enhancing their expertise in structural analysis and design. This program delves into the latest methodologies and technologies used in topological analysis, providing a comprehensive understanding of how to assess and improve the structural integrity of a wide range of materials and structures, from civil infrastructure to aerospace components. Participants will explore advanced computational tools and software, learn to apply topological principles to optimize structural designs, and gain insights into predictive modeling for durability and sustainability.
Upon completion, learners will develop robust skills in topological data analysis, structural optimization techniques, and the integration of topological methods with traditional engineering practices. They will be equipped to conduct detailed stress and strain analyses, interpret complex topological data, and apply these findings to create more efficient, resilient, and sustainable structural designs. These skills are crucial for advancing careers in structural engineering, material science, and related fields, positioning professionals to lead or contribute effectively to projects requiring cutting-edge structural integrity assessments and solutions.

Topics Covered
- Foundational Concepts: Covers the core principles and key terminology.: Topological Spaces: Introduces the mathematical foundations of topological spaces.
- Homotopy and Homology: Explores the concepts of homotopy and homology in topological analysis.: Applications in Engineering: Demonstrates how topological methods are applied in engineering contexts.
- Computational Topology: Focuses on algorithms and software tools for topological analysis.: Case Studies: Analyzes real-world structural integrity issues using topological techniques.
